The Historical Significance of Italian Furniture
The legacy of Italian furniture dates back to the Renaissance, a period that celebrated art and innovation. During this time, artisans began to incorporate intricate designs and high-quality materials into their furniture creations. Key points in the history of Italian furniture include:
- The Renaissance Era: Famous for ornate details and grandiose styles, furniture was intricately carved from wood and embellished with gold leaf.
- The Baroque Period: Characterized by dramatic forms and rich colors, this era brought about heavy and imposing furniture pieces.
- The Modern Movement: 20th-century designers like Gio Ponti and Ettore Sottsass revolutionized Italian furniture with sleek lines and bold colors.
Each of these periods has contributed significantly to the evolution and prominence of Italian furniture in the global market.

Popular Styles of Italian Furniture
Italian furniture encompasses a variety of styles, each with its unique flair. Some of the most popular include:
1. Classic Italian Furniture
Characterized by ornate carvings and rich materials, classic Italian furniture enhances traditional interiors. Pieces often feature baroque and renaissance influences.
2. Modern Italian Furniture
This style emphasizes clean lines, minimalism, and functional design. Modern Italian designers are known for their innovative use of space and materials.
3. Contemporary Italian Furniture
Fusing tradition with modern aesthetics, contemporary Italian furniture reflects current trends while paying homage to classic designs. These pieces often utilize sustainable materials and cutting-edge technology.
4. Rustic Italian Furniture
Rustic styles evoke warmth and charm, often using reclaimed wood and organic finishes to create a cozy ambiance reminiscent of Italian countryside homes.

Where to Find Authentic Italian Furniture
When searching for authentic Italian furniture, it is crucial to know where to look. Here are some tips:
- Specialized Retailers: Look for stores that specialize in Italian imports. Brands like B&B Italia and Minotti are renowned for their quality.
- Furniture Shows: Attend exhibitions like Salone del Mobile in Milan, where you can experience the latest designs and innovations in Italian furniture.
- Online Platforms: Explore trusted online retailers that offer a wide range of Italian furniture, ensuring authenticity through customer reviews and return policies.
Maintaining Your Italian Furniture
Caring for your Italian furniture ensures its beauty and durability last for years. Here are some maintenance tips:
1. Regular Cleaning
Dust your furniture regularly with a soft cloth. Avoid harsh chemicals that can damage the finish.
2. Protect from Sunlight
Direct sunlight can fade colors over time. Use curtains or place furniture away from windows to protect it from UV rays.
3. Professional Care
For deeper cleaning or repairs, consider hiring professionals who specialize in restoring high-end furniture.
